Работа с матрицами - C (СИ)

Узнай цену своей работы

Формулировка задачи:

Задана матрица A вещественных чисел размера N × N (N ≤ 20, задается как параметр). По- строить по ней матрицу B того же размера, элемент b[i][j] которой равен сумме модулей всех тех элементов матрицы A, которые расположены в некоторой ее области (на соответствующем рисунке закрашена), определяемой по номеру строки i и номеру столбца j так, как показано на рисунке (границы входят в область). На печать следует вывести как исходную, так и результирующую матрицу. P.S: Не могу понять, как строить матрицу B. Как я понял, там должен быть посчитан один элемент, а все остальные - нули, но я не уверен.

Решение задачи: «Работа с матрицами»

textual
Листинг программы
for(i=0; i<n; i++)=""  for(j="0;" j<n;="" j++)="" {=""  ="" b[i][j]="0;" for(i1="i;" i1<n;="" i1++)="" left="j" -="" (i1="" i);="" if="" (left="" <="" 0)="" right="j" +="" (right=""> N-1{ right = N-1;
    for(j1=left;j1<=right; j1++)
       b[i][j] +=  a[i1][j1];
    }
 }</n;>

ИИ для рефератов и докладов


  • Экспорт Word по ГОСТу
  • Минимум 80% уникальности текста
  • Поиск релевантных источников в интернете
  • Готовый документ за 2 минуты

Оцени полезность:

6   голосов , оценка 3.667 из 5
Похожие ответы